BMW India has announced that it will be launching the new 2 Series Gran Coupe M Performance edition on September 7. The new special edition 2 Series will be sold in limited numbers and will be available with a petrol powertrain only.
The M Performance edition only adds cosmetic upgrades over the standard BMW 2 Series Gran Coupe. Offered in a single colour, Black Sapphire with contrasting silver accents on the grille, bumper and wing mirrors, the new BMW 2 Series will feature an M Performance grille, gear selector lever and a few other M-specific parts.
Moving inside, the 2023 BMW 220i M Performance edition gets a black and beige dual-tone interior. In terms of features, it will likely be similar to the regular 2 Series Gran Coupe. Key highlights include dual 10.25-inch screens for the infotainment system and digital instrument cluster, wireless Android Auto and Apple CarPlay, head-up display, dual-zone climate control, wireless charger, and more.
BMW will offer the 2 Series M Performance edition with the same powertrain as the 220i. The 2.0-litre turbo-petrol motor pumps out 179 bhp with 280 Nm of peak torque. Transmission duties are handled by a 7-speed DCT automatic gearbox.
BMW will launch the new BMW 220i M Performance edition on 7 September 2023 and also unveil its prices. Expect it to be priced slightly over the M Sport Pro trim, which is priced at Rs 45.50 lakh (ex-showroom). BMW has already started accepting bookings for a token amount of Rs 1.5 lakh.
In India, the 2 Series Gran Coupe has only one competitor, the Mercedes A-Class limousine which is priced at Rs 45.80 lakh (ex-showroom).
